William Buchanan was born in 1881, Blackfriars, Glasgow, Lanarkshire. Parents being William Kellie and Agnes Buchanan. [1]
1881 On the 8 day of August, Baptism was held at the Plantation Church, Glasgow, Lanark, Scotland. [2]
1891 Residence Nicholas Street, Blackfriars, Lanarkshire. William Kellie age 9 years, recorded as attending School ( Scholar), son of William Kellie age 57 years, occupation Dealer, birthplace Lanarkshire, mother W Kellie age 33 ? ( 53), birthplace Lanarkshire. Siblings in the household Charles Kellie age 17, occupation Picture Frame Maker, David Kellie age 15, occupation Van Boy and George Kellie age 12, occupation Message Boy. All children birthplace recorded as Lanarkshire. Scotland. [3]
1891 William's father William Kellie age 57 years died. Death registered in the District of Blackfriars. [4]
1907 On the 22nd day of February at Calton Parish Church, Glasgow. After Banns according to the Forms of the Church of Scotland. William Buchanan Kellie age 25, bachelor, occupation Tin Box Maker, residence 23 Oswald Street, Bridgeton, Glasgow, father William Kellie (dec), occupation Pickle Manufacturer, mother Agnes m.s. Buchanan, Kellie. Married Elizabeth Bestage 18, spinster, occupation Power Loom Weaver, residence 23 Oswald Street, Bridgeton, Glasgow, father John Best, occupation Lamplighter, mother Agnes m.s Gaw, Best. Witnesses Joseph Johnston and Maggie Connell.
Rev W Chalmers Smith. [5]
